Pixorial is a cloud-based consumer video storage and editing platform. [1] The company was formed in 2007, in Englewood, CO as a media conversion service.[2] In 2013, Pixorial was chosen as one of two video storage companies to partner with the launch of Google Drive. [3]

History

Founded in 2007 and launched in 2009 by Netscape veteran, Andres Espineira, Pixorial sought to capitalize on media conversion in the digital age. [4] With a new focus on easy to use video editing software in 2009, Pixorial began developing an app that would be launched for iOS and Android users in 2011. [5] Later developments in the app in 2012 would also included real time filters, which were later removed. [6] With the launch of Google Drive in 2012, Pixorial was chosen as an integrated video partner. [7] This integration with Google Drive allowed users to access videos stored in Google Drive within the web app of Pixorial. [8] After the Google Drive launch, Pixorial developed a crowd sourced, location based video sharing app, Krowds. [9] The app was cited in July of 2012 by PC Magazine as one of "The 8 Best Apps for Making and Sharing Videos on Your iPhone". [10] In late July, PiMyPlayerxorial replaced its original mobile app with the MyPlayer HD app that optimized HD video viewing for large screen viewing including tablets and smart televisions. Krowds App

Pixorial's app was launched in April of 2013 as a tool to aggregate event videos through location based collections. [13] The app was launched to generally positive review. The application was initially lauched for iOS but was followed by an Android release in May. [14] The app was later rebranded as Krowds Video by Pixorial.
